mysqld 使用

--standalone   会有err 文件写在 bin 下

 

 

 

mysqld --console

### mysqld MySQL服务器守护进程介绍 mysqld 是 MySQL 数据库的核心服务进程,负责处理 SQL 查询请求以及管理数据存储引擎的操作。作为 Linux 系统中的一个守护进程[^2],mysqld 能够在后台持续运行,独立于任何特定的用户会话。 当 MySQL 服务器启动时,实际上会有两个相关联的进程存在:一个是 `mysqld` 自身;另一个是由 `mysqld_safe` 启动脚本所创建用于监控和服务保护机制的父进程[^1]。这种设计确保即使主数据库进程意外崩溃也能自动恢复。 #### 主要功能特性 - **持久化背景执行**:作为一个典型的守护程序,mysqld 不依赖终端连接,在系统引导完成后即开始工作直到关闭为止。 - **资源隔离**:为了提高安全性和稳定性,通常建议以较低权限账户身份运行此服务,并且可以通过配置文件调整其占用内存大小和其他性能参数。 - **多线程架构支持并发访问**:内部采用多线程模型来高效应对来自客户端应用程序的同时请求。 ```bash # 查看当前正在运行的 mysqld 进程状态 ps aux | grep mysqld ``` #### 配置与优化 mysqld 的行为受多个因素影响,包括但不限于: - `/etc/my.cnf` 或者其他位置定义的全局设置; - 命令行传递给启动命令的具体选项; - 表空间布局及其对应的磁盘 I/O 性能特征。 对于生产环境下的部署而言,合理规划这些方面有助于提升整体表现力并减少潜在风险点。 #### 日常维护操作指南 定期备份重要数据、检查索引健康状况以及清理不再使用的对象都是管理员日常工作中不可或缺的部分。此外,还应该密切关注官方发布的补丁更新通知,及时应用修复已知漏洞的安全措施。 mysqld 守护进程中记录的日志信息同样至关重要,它们不仅帮助定位故障原因还能辅助分析长期趋势变化规律。默认情况下,错误日志会被写入到由 my.cnf 文件指定的位置。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值